Crash



Crash

Synopsis:
Created by the well-known intergenerational company, Roots&Branches, this show turns the economic crisis into an unprecedented opportunity to bring the generations together. The wisdom, stories and strength of the elders, the roots, have never been so relevant, as the young branches try to cope with the sudden changes in their economic prospects. How do we live with fear? What gives us security? Can I actually give up bottled water? With its singular brand of theatrical humor, poignancy, Drama and style Roots&Branches uniquely provides audiences with hope, insight and joy in these hardening times. The play fosters spirited dialogue with the audience in an open post-show discussion and open new avenues of intergenerational understanding.
